| Markings | Markings will adhere to prescribed specifications in A999/A999M and shall include the NPS or OD and schedule number or average wall thickness, heat number, and NH (when hydrotesting is not performed) and ET (when eddy-current testing is performed) or UT (when ultrasonic testing is performed). The marking shall also include the manufacturer's private identifying mark, the marking requirement of section 12.3 on Hydrostatic or Nondestructive Electric Test, if applicable, and whether seamless (SML), welded (WLD), or heavily cold-worked (HCW). For Grades TP304H, TP316H, TP321H & TP347H, the marking shall also include the heat number and heat-treatment lot identification. | |
| Flattening Test | For material heat treated in a continuous furnace flattening tests shall be made on a sufficient number of pipes to constitute 5% of the lot, but in no case less than 2 lengths of pipe. | |
| Hydrostatic or Nondestructive Testing | Each pipe shall be subjected to the nondestructive electric test or the hydrostatic test | |

2. Seamless Cold Rolling (Cold drawn) Processes
Round Pipe Billet → Heating → Perforation → Head → Annealing → Pickling → Oil (Copper) → Multi Pass Drawing (Cold Rolling) → Billet → Heat Treatment → Straightening → Water Pressure Test → Marking → Storage
